Owl in wheel of plane delays flight out of Portland airport

A barn owl, similar to the one pictured, was found in the wheel well of a plane at Portland International Airport.

PORTLAND, Ore. — A flight out of Portland International Airport was delayed last week when flight crew saw a owl in a plane.

KGW reported that a barn owl was in the wheel well of a small PenAir plane.

Crew members found the owl during pre-flight checks, according to KGW. They were able to get the owl out of the well and release it in a safe location.

The plane was at the airport overnight and was stored in an older hanger that typically has owls around it, according to an airline spokesman.

After a 25-minute delay, the flight took off for Eureka, California.
